Aim | To evaluate public health perspective and important working areas and public health point of view for health issues. |
Course Content | This course contains; Health and basic health services concept,Basic philosophy, scope and principles of public health, Healthy nutrition and physical exercise,Improving nutrition status of community,Reproductive health and family planning,Women's health,Communicable diseases, Childen's health,Children's health,Health of elderly,Chronic diseases,Mental and social health,Occupational and environmental health,General review and discussion. |
